Abstract

resumo “substrato de meio revestido, método para fazer um substrato de meio revestido e sistema para impressão de jato a tinta” a presente revelação refere-se aos substratos de meio revestidos, bem como, sistemas e métodos relacionados. em um exemplo, um substrato de meio revestido para impressão de tinta a jato pode compreender uma camada de recebimento de tinta revestida em pelo menos um lado de um substrato, e pode ser formulado para aceitar uma composição de tinta a jato. a camada de recebimento de tinta pode compreender um agente de brilho óptico, um sal ácido orgânico, um aglutinante, um pigmento e um portador polimérico de peso molecular baixo tendo um peso molecular médio ponderado menor do que 50.000 mw. 1/1
